Your MBA recommenders should ideally be direct supervisors or senior colleagues who have closely observed your professional performance, leadership, and impact. Admissions committees value recommenders who can speak with specificity about your contributions and growth. Avoid choosing recommenders solely based on their title or prestige—someone who knows your work intimately will always write a more persuasive letter than a high-profile name who barely knows you.
